我们点击下配置列表即可查看我们列表页的配置信息了:
其实这个最简单了,首先我们先来完成他控制器的代码:
public function lists(){ $mod = M('Conf')->select(); $this -> assign('mod',$mod); $this -> display(); }
查找到了,后我们直接到列表页进行遍历数据即可:
<!doctype html> <html> <head> <meta charset="UTF-8"> <title>后台管理</title> <link rel="stylesheet" type="text/css" href="__PUBLIC__/Admin/css/common.css"/> <link rel="stylesheet" type="text/css" href="__PUBLIC__/Admin/css/main.css"/> <script type="text/javascript" src="__PUBLIC__/Admin/js/libs/modernizr.min.js"></script> <script type="text/javascript" src="__PUBLIC__/Admin/js/jq18m.js"></script> <script type="text/javascript" src="__PUBLIC__/Admin/js/hileft.js"></script> <style> table{ width:100%; table-layout:fixed;/* 只有定义了表格的布局算法为fixed,下面td的定义才能起作用。 */ } td{ width:100%; word-break:keep-all;/* 不换行 */ white-space:nowrap;/* 不换行 */ overflow:hidden;/* 内容超出宽度时隐藏超出部分的内容 */ text-overflow:ellipsis;/* 当对象内文本溢出时显示省略标记(...) ;需与overflow:hidden;一起使用*/ } </style> </head> <body> <include file="Public/header" /> <div class="container clearfix"> <include file="Public/left" /> <!--/sidebar--> <div class="main-wrap"> <div class="crumb-wrap"> <div class="crumb-list"><i class="icon-font">�</i><a href="/jscss/admin">首页</a><span class="crumb-step">></span><span class="crumb-name">作品管理</span></div> </div> <div class="search-wrap"> <div class="search-content"> <form action="__CONTROLLER__/tdel" method="post"> <table class="search-tab"> <tr> <th width="120">选择分类:</th> <td> <select name="search-sort" id=""> <option value="">全部</option> <option value="19">精品界面</option><option value="20">推荐界面</option> </select> </td> <th width="70">关键字:</th> <td><input class="common-text" placeholder="关键字" name="keywords" value="" id="" type="text"></td> <td><input class="btn btn-primary btn2" name="sub" value="查询" type="submit"></td> </tr> </table> </form> </div> </div> <div class="result-wrap"> <form name="myform" id="myform" method="post" action="__CONTROLLER__/tdel"> <div class="result-title"> <div class="result-list"> <a href="insert.html"><i class="icon-font">�</i>新增作品</a> <a id="batchDel" href="javascript:void(0)"><i class="icon-font">�</i>批量删除</a> <a id="updateOrd" href="javascript:void(0)"><i class="icon-font">�</i>更新排序</a> </div> </div> <div class="result-content"> <table class="result-tab" width="100%"> <tr> <th>网站名称</th> <th>网站英文名称</th> <th>描述Description</th> <th>关键词Keywords</th> <th>网站备案信息</th> <th>操作</th> </tr> <volist name="mod" id="vo"> <tr> <td>{$vo['cf_name']}</td> <td>{$vo['cf_ename']}</td> <if condition="$vo['cf_desc'] eq ''"> <td style="color:red;"><b>抱歉您还没填写任何数据</b></td> <else /> <td class="da">{$vo['cf_desc']}</td> </if> <if condition="$vo['cf_keywords'] eq ''"> <td style="color:red;"><b>抱歉您还没填写任何数据</b></td> <else /> <td class="da">{$vo['cf_keywords']}</td> </if> <if condition="$vo['cf_keywords'] eq ''"> <td style="color:red;"><b>抱歉您还没填写任何数据</b></td> <else /> <td class="da">{$vo['cf_record']}</td> </if> <td> <a class="link-update" href="__MODULE__/Conf/edit/cf_id/{$vo['cf_id']}">编辑网站配置</a> </td> </tr> </volist> </table> <div class="list-page"> {$pageHtml}</div> </div> </form> </div> </div> <!--/main--> <script> //在 jq 1.8.3测试成功 $("#selall").click(function(){ if($(this).attr("checked")){ $('.selall').attr("checked","checked"); }else{ $('.selall').removeAttr("checked"); } }); </script> </div> </body> </html>
这样我们的效果即可实现出来了